Brentz signed a one-year minor league deal with the Red Sox that includes an invitation to spring training, Brendan McGair of the Pawtucket Times reports.
EDGE Analysis
The 30-year-old Brentz will rejoin the organization he started with back in 2010. The Red Sox eventually cut ties with Brentz -- the victim of a roster crunch -- after the 2017 season. There's some power potential, having whacked 46 home runs with an .877 OPS over 175 games at the Triple-A level the last two seasons. The deal also includes opt-out language, allowing Brentz to bolt if a better opportunity comes along. He's not expected to challenge for a spot in Boston, so if he remains in the organization, he'll play the outfield at Triple-A Pawtucket.

Brentz was claimed off waivers by the Mets on Monday, Adam Berry of MLB.com reports.
EDGE Analysis
Brentz will join the Mets after being designated for assignment by the Pirates over the weekend. The 29-year-old outfielder, who is out of options, could stick on the Mets' roster as a temporary replacement for Michael Conforto, though there's also a chance the team tries to send him through waivers. He led the International League with 31 homers in 2017 while also hitting .271/.334/.529 in 494 plate appearances.

Brentz was traded to Pittsburgh for cash considerations Tuesday.
EDGE Analysis
The Red Sox no longer had room for Brentz on the 40-man roster after signing J.D. Martinez. The 29-year-old outfielder spent the entirety of the 2017 season at Triple-A Pawtucket, hitting .271/.334/.529 with 31 homers in 120 games. He'll fight for a bench spot in Pittsburgh this spring.
